Hi Tristan! I am from Croatia and I will try to explain to you where you are wrong.
1. When a person finishes some craft school, such as hairdresser, carpenter, car mechanic, if they know they craft these people earn more money than those who finish high school and college.
2.When you order water in Croatia, you will get plain water. I have not in my 40 years of life experienced someone asking me what you stated.
3. In Croatia, vacations last 10 to 15 days, at most.
4.True, You were right about this one.
5.The small sinks you describe are mostly in hostels or apartments for tourists. In Croatia we have signs for bathrooms of normal size.
I personally and everyone I know prefer the big ones.
6.The truth is that most windows in Croatia look like that, You were right about this one.
7.Croats don't go out with wet hair when it's winter outside, because they would catch a cold just like an American would catch a cold when he went out in the cold with wet hair.
8.Croats are a proud people in every way. You were right about this one.
9.True. You were right about this one.
10.Croats leave their homeland for other countries not because they like it, but because the economy is a disaster and because there is a lot of corruption and economic crime
